The royal library gardens are a landscaped area, dating from 1920, and which are situated within the Christianborg complex, on Slotsholmen. They are a popular, yet peaceful place, ideal as a quiet spot to enjoy reading a book or eat lunch. There is a modern fountain in the centre which erupts with water once an hour, on the hour. The flowerbeds are well-maintained and there are plenty of established trees. As well as the fountain, the gardens feature a famous statue of philosopher Søren Kierkegaard.
